ORDINANCE NO. 792-96
AN ORDINANCE AMENDING SECTION 8 "GRIEVANCE
COMMITTEE" OF CHAPTER 13 "ADVISORY BOARDS" OF
THE CODE OF ORDINANCES, CITY OF RICHLAND HILLS,
TEXAS; CREATING A NEW RICHLAND HILLS GRIEVANCE
COMMITTEE; PROVIDING QUALIFICATIONS FOR MEMBERS
OF SAID COMMITTEE; PROVIDING FOR STAFF SUPPORT;
PROVIDING FOR CERTAIN RECORD KEEPING BY THE CITY
SECRETARY; DEFINING QUORUM REQUIREMENTS;
PROVIDING A SEVERABILITY CLAUSE; PROVIDING A
SAVING CLAUSE; AND PROVIDING AN EFFECTIVE DATE.
BE IT ORDAINED BY TH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F RICHLAND
HILLS, TEXAS:
I.
That Section 8 "GRIEVANCE COMMITTEE" of Chapter 13 "ADVISORY
BOARDS" of the Code of Ordinances of the City of Richland Hills, Texas, as
amended, be hereby amended in the following specified particulars:
• A. Subsection A "CREATION; QUALIFICATIONS OF MEMBERS" of said
Section 8 shall be hereby amended to hereafter be and read as follows:
A. CREATION: OUALIFICATIONS OF MEMBERS
1. The Richland Hills Grievance Committee is hereby
established. It shall be composed of a standing board of five (5)
employee members and two (2) citizen members. Only regular,
full time employees may vote on the election of employee
members. For the purpose of determining employee
membership, and to achieve a fair and equitable apportionment
of employee representation, one person from each of the
following departments shall be elected by those respective
departmental members to serve on said board:
(a) Fire Department;
(b) Police Department;
(c) Public Services Department;
(d) Library; and
(e) City Hall/Administration.
•
•
Only regular, full time employees shall be eligible for election
to a committee from these departments, and department heads
are ineligible to be elected. The City Council shall have the
authority to appoint the two citizen members of the Grievance
Committee by a majority vote on an at-large basis. Such
citizen members shall be registered voters on the date of their
appointment, and may not serve in any capacity on more than
one other Richland Hills standing board, commission and
committee, or any special committee exceeding six month's
duration; or serve as city representative to a local, state or
national organization.
2. Members of the Grievance Committee shall serve terms of two
(2) years. Appointed members shall be seated in even
numbered years and elected members shall be seated in odd
numbered years; provided, however, that the initial Grievance
Committee members under this ordinance shall be appointed
and elected as soon as reasonably practicable after the final
passage of this ordinance. Members shall be appointed in
January, or as soon as reasonably practicable thereafter.
B. Subsection C "VACANCIES; UNEXPIRED TERMS" shall be hereby
amended to hereafter be and read as follows:
. C. VACANCIES; UNEXPIRED TERMS
Any vacancy occurring in the membership of the committee shall be
filled by appointment and approval of the City Council or by election
by fellow departmental employees in the same manner as provided
hereinabove for appointment of members for full terms, such
appointments to be for the remainder of the unexpired term of the
member whose place become vacant, subject, however, to eligibility
requirements stated in this section.
C. Subsection D "OFFICERS" of said Section 8 shall be hereby amended to
hereafter be and read as follows:
D. OFFICERS
The officers of the committee shall be a chairman, who shall be
elected by a majority vote of the members at their first
organizational meeting, and thereafter when the incumbent shall
leave office for any reason. The remaining officers shall be a vice
chairman and secretary, who shall be elected by a majority vote of
the members. Each board shall be responsible for setting up their
own needs. In the event staff support is needed, it should be
coordinated through the City Manager's office. A chairman, vice
chairman and secretary shall meet the minimum office requirements
for each board, commission, and committee.

D. Subsection E "MEETINGS, HEARING, RULES OF PROCEDURE AND
QUORUM" of said Section 8 shall be hereby amended by the deletion of
the first sentence of said section and by the replacement of said first
sentence with the following language:
The Committee shall hold meetings as required by the personnel
policies of the City of Richland Hills, as same may from time to
time be amended by ordinance.
E. Subsection I "APPLICATIONS" of said Section 8 shall be hereby amended
by the addition of the following language to the end of said Subsection as
it currently exists.
"The City Secretary shall maintain previously filed applications
indefinitely of an appointed board, commission or committee
member if said member is to be considered for reappointment by the
City Council and said member has expressed a desire to continue
serving on said board, commission or committee."
II.
Severability Clause. That it is hereby declared to be the intention of the City
Council that the sections, paragraphs, sentences, clauses and phrases of this
. ordinance are severable, and if any phrase, clause, sentence, paragraph or section of
this ordinance shall be declared invalid or unconstitutional by the valid judgment or
decree of any court of competent jurisdiction, such invalidity or unconstitutionality
shall not affect any of the remaining phrases, clauses, sentences, paragraphs and
sections of this ordinance, since the same would have been enacted by the City
Council without the incorporation in this ordinance of any such invalid or
unconstitutional phrase, clause, sentence, paragraph or section.
III.
Saving Clause. That Chapter 13 of the Code of Ordinances, City of Richland
Hills, Texas, as amended, shall remain in full force and effect, save and except as
amended by this ordinance.
IV.
Effective Date. This ordinance shall be in full force and effect from and after
its passage and publication as provided by the Richland Hills City Charter and the
laws of the State of Texas.
